Celebrating 59 years since its founding, our association is centered around Kurashiki City, Okayama Prefecture, and is comprised of 12 companies, including companies that mainly produce canvas, thick fabrics, and denim fabrics from yarn dyeing. We boast one of the highest production volumes and high quality canvases in Japan, and we also manufacture and sell secondary products under original brands such as Kurashiki Hanpu. By working with a variety of materials, yarn-dyed denim has become highly functional and of high quality, and products such as nylon denim are being developed. |

We use 60 old-shuttle looms to produce heavy fabrics such as canvas. Since we consistently carry out everything from twisted yarn to weaving, we can supply fabrics with stable quality. The material is mainly linen, acrylic, polyester, etc. centering on cotton. In recent years, in addition to textiles for industrial materials, the recognition of high value-added material “Kurashiki Canvas” has been increasing. In-house has a department that handles fabric processing and OEM of products, and as a factory that handles canvas materials, it meets the needs of a wide range of customers. |
